From b3119118d5fb1e19cf71265d20408f1f601a1ee3 Mon Sep 17 00:00:00 2001 From: Iván Ávalos Date: Wed, 28 Feb 2024 09:01:03 -0600 Subject: [wallet] Show version info even when not in developer mode bug 0008536 --- .../main/java/net/taler/wallet/settings/SettingsFragment.kt | 13 +++++-------- 1 file changed, 5 insertions(+), 8 deletions(-) (limited to 'wallet/src/main/java/net/taler/wallet/settings/SettingsFragment.kt') diff --git a/wallet/src/main/java/net/taler/wallet/settings/SettingsFragment.kt b/wallet/src/main/java/net/taler/wallet/settings/SettingsFragment.kt index a9881bf..6af5ed1 100644 --- a/wallet/src/main/java/net/taler/wallet/settings/SettingsFragment.kt +++ b/wallet/src/main/java/net/taler/wallet/settings/SettingsFragment.kt @@ -60,8 +60,6 @@ class SettingsFragment : PreferenceFragmentCompat() { prefLogcat, prefExportDb, prefImportDb, - prefVersionApp, - prefVersionCore, prefVersionExchange, prefVersionMerchant, prefTest, @@ -99,14 +97,13 @@ class SettingsFragment : PreferenceFragmentCompat() { override fun onViewCreated(view: View, savedInstanceState: Bundle?) { super.onViewCreated(view, savedInstanceState) + prefVersionApp.summary = "$VERSION_NAME ($FLAVOR $VERSION_CODE)" + prefVersionCore.summary = "${model.walletVersion} (${model.walletVersionHash?.take(7)})" + model.exchangeVersion?.let { prefVersionExchange.summary = it } + model.merchantVersion?.let { prefVersionMerchant.summary = it } + model.devMode.observe(viewLifecycleOwner) { enabled -> prefDevMode.isChecked = enabled - if (enabled) { - prefVersionApp.summary = "$VERSION_NAME ($FLAVOR $VERSION_CODE)" - prefVersionCore.summary = "${model.walletVersion} (${model.walletVersionHash?.take(7)})" - model.exchangeVersion?.let { prefVersionExchange.summary = it } - model.merchantVersion?.let { prefVersionMerchant.summary = it } - } devPrefs.forEach { it.isVisible = enabled } } prefDevMode.setOnPreferenceChangeListener { _, newValue -> -- cgit v1.2.3